KEA128 存储器映像与WDOG寄存器详解
需积分: 49 183 浏览量
更新于2024-08-08
收藏 7.7MB PDF 举报
"这篇文档是KEA128子系列参考手册的一部分,主要讨论了存储器映像和寄存器定义,特别是与WDOG(Watchdog Timer)相关的寄存器。文档适用于S9KEAZ系列的微控制器。"
在微控制器设计中,存储器映像是指将内存空间分配给特定的功能单元,如寄存器或I/O设备。在这个例子中,我们关注的是WDOG(Watchdog Timer)的存储器映像和寄存器定义。WDOG是一种系统监控设备,用于确保系统的稳定运行,如果检测到异常情况,它会执行复位操作。
WDOG的寄存器包括:
1. WDOG控制和状态寄存器1 (WDOG_CS1) - 用于配置和查看WDOG的状态。EN位用于启用或禁用WDOG,INT位则表示中断状态。
2. WDOG控制和状态寄存器2 (WDOG_CS2) - 可能包含额外的控制和状态信息。
3. WDOG计数器寄存器(高位和低位) - 显示WDOG内部计数器的当前值。
4. WDOG定时溢出值寄存器(高位和低位) - 设定WDOG计数器溢出的时间间隔。
5. WDOG窗口寄存器(高位和低位) - 设置一个时间窗口,如果在此窗口外没有重置WDOG,也会触发复位。
对于WDOG_CS1寄存器,EN位被写入1时启用WDOG,0则禁用。INT位在WDOG中断发生时被置1。其它位如UPDATE、TST、DBG、WAIT和STOP可能涉及更新控制、测试模式、调试模式、等待状态和停止模式等操作,具体功能需要参照手册的详细描述。
KEA128是一款基于ARMCortex-M0+内核的微控制器,具备多种功能模块,如系统模块、存储器和存储器接口、时钟管理、安全和完整性模块、模拟模块、定时器、通信接口和人机接口。手册还涵盖了芯片配置,包括模块间互连和内核模块的具体配置选项,提供了对这些高级功能的深入了解。
这个资源详细介绍了KEA128微控制器中WDOG模块的寄存器结构和用法,对于理解和编程控制该微控制器的看门狗功能至关重要。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2021-10-02 上传
2008-10-28 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
美自
- 粉丝: 16
- 资源: 3946
最新资源
- Python中快速友好的MessagePack序列化库msgspec
- 大学生社团管理系统设计与实现
- 基于Netbeans和JavaFX的宿舍管理系统开发与实践
- NodeJS打造Discord机器人:kazzcord功能全解析
- 小学教学与管理一体化:校务管理系统v***
- AppDeploy neXtGen:无需代理的Windows AD集成软件自动分发
- 基于SSM和JSP技术的网上商城系统开发
- 探索ANOIRA16的GitHub托管测试网站之路
- 语音性别识别:机器学习模型的精确度提升策略
- 利用MATLAB代码让古董486电脑焕发新生
- Erlang VM上的分布式生命游戏实现与Elixir设计
- 一键下载管理 - Go to Downloads-crx插件
- Java SSM框架开发的客户关系管理系统
- 使用SQL数据库和Django开发应用程序指南
- Spring Security实战指南:详细示例与应用
- Quarkus项目测试展示柜:Cucumber与FitNesse实践